Mick Roe
Module Leader, Music Business Studies
Michael teaches Music Business at BIMM Institute Dublin. A graduate of the National University of Ireland Maynooth, Michael started as a musician playing drums in various bands, including Adebisi Shank. He began working in the industry as an agent, booking tours for artists in Europe and Asia. He co-founded the Irish independent label Richter Collective releasing records from acts such as And So I Watch You From Afar, The Redneck Manifesto and Enemies building it into an internationally respected company with worldwide distribution.
In 2011, Michael set up MKR Management, which offers consultancy, artist management and label services to US independent labels wishing to set up in Europe. Having worked with the likes of Sargent House (Chelsea Wolfe, Deafheaven, Tera Melos) he began managing Dublin-based band All Tvvins, among others.
Now at Faction Records Michael works across management, publishing and label duties with artists such as James Vincent McMorrow, Sorcha Richardson, Martin Hayes, Jape and Uly amongst others.
